International Academy of Music: 14th Music Festival in Italy

Posted on July 25, 2016August 2, 2016 by Bella Hwang

 

International - 725
Pictured is the view of Castelnuovo di Garfagnana, the music festival’s location. [Source: Boyoung B. Hwang]
Reporting from Italy

In Castelnuovo di Garfagnana, Italy, the International Academy of Music’s annual music festival invites young musicians from around the world to showcase their talent through classical music. The International Academy of Music teams up with the town of Castelnuovo di Garfagnana, the city of Lucca, the region of Tuscany, and various other local organizations in order to present the festival. Every year, the festival is held June 25th to July 8th, giving the townspeople of Castelnuovo di Garfagnana a chance to enjoy beautiful music created by the students and faculty alike. This year, the International Academy of Music presented its fourteenth festival titled ‘XIV Festival 2016.’

Works by composers ranging from Beethoven to Debussy to Balakirev were featured in ‘XIV Festival 2016.’ Each student at the International Academy of Music performed at least one solo piece and one chamber music piece, which is a collaborative piece between two or more musicians. Although students were busy practicing and making music, they were given the chance to go sightseeing in Lucca, Tuscany. Students also frequented local shops and gelaterias, getting a feel for the local atmosphere and making irreplaceable friendships along the way.

A student of the International Academy of Music, Francesca Bernard, tells JSR, “I’m definitely coming back next year. It was such a great experience playing with other student musicians around the world, and I’m so glad that I decided to spend my summer here.”

Directors of the International Academy of Music Efrem Briskin, Massimiliano Mainolfi, and Piero Gaddi gave a speech at the final concert of the festival, congratulating all of the students and faculty on completing another successful International Academy of Music festival. They then proceeded to award certificates of participation to each student.
“We created so much beautiful music in the town of Castelnuovo di Garfagnana thanks to all of you. These past couple of days have gone by so quickly, yet you’ve all given wonderful performances. Thank you so much for being a part of this year’s festival.” Director Massimiliano Mainolfi stated.
